Lieutenant-General G.N. Molesworth CSI, CBE
Molesworth spent 12 years as a regimental officer on the North-West Frontier. He served with the Somerset Light Infantry through the Third Afghan War, going later as Deputy Assistant Adjutant-General at Indian Army H.Q. He then transferred to the 25th Punjabis in the Indian Army. He then undertook various staff posts.
